An Athens woman was arrested after allegedly stabbing her cheating boyfriend during an argument over her refusal to get out of bed and drive him to work.

Randi Marie Houser, 30, instead suggested that her boyfriend “call one of his other women,” according to the Athens Banner-Herald. Houser dropped him off at Athens Regional Medical Center and left.

Houser’s boyfriend first attempted to cover up the assault, telling staff that he had fallen on a piece of glass and had a friend drive him to the hospital, according to the Banner-Herald. After an employee alerted police that a possible assault victim was seeking treatment, police arrived at the hospital and officers went to the couple’s home to question Houser.

The boyfriend changed his story when officers told him that Houser had allegedly confessed to the stabbing, according to the Banner-Herald.

Houser was charged with aggravated assault.
